so far
英 [səʊ fɑː(r)]
美 [soʊ fɑːr]
(只能到)如此程度,这个地步; 迄今为止;到目前为止
英英释义
adv
- used in negative statement to describe a situation that has existed up to this point or up to the present time
- So far he hasn't called
- the sun isn't up yet
- used after a superlative
- this is the best so far
- the largest drug bust yet
- to the degree or extent that
- insofar as it can be ascertained, the horse lung is comparable to that of man
- so far as it is reasonably practical he should practice restraint
